Director of Camps and Adventure – St. Columba

Site Name: St. Columba Position Title: Director of Camps and Adventure Position Type:  Year-Round Location (city and state): Memphis, Tennessee Salary Range: $30,000 to $35,000 Benefits: The position is full-time with $30k-$35k salary, health and retirement benefits, and includes on-site housing in a 400 sq ft tiny home. We also expect to offer a three bedroom home when one comes available. Our current Camp Director is not moving on, he is moving up and becoming Associate Executive Director for Facilities so we are well-equipped to ensure a smooth transition. Because it is late April, we have the ability to either find someone who wants to start soon, or someone who finishes their responsibilities at another camp and moves to Memphis this Fall. To apply email cover letter and resume to brad@saintcolumbamemphis.org Job Description: Camps represent the center’s most thriving youth community, revenue center and opportunity for growth. As the principal leader of the Mud Camp, Camp Able & other St. Columba sponsored camping/youth programs, s/he will plan, develop, execute, and establish policies and objectives in accordance with industry-accepted camp standards and age-appropriate recreational learning. S/he will be responsible for growing camp programs to reach budgeted revenue and expense goals to support St. Columba’s ministries. In addition to his/her role as Camp Director, s/he will act as St. Columba’s primary adventure leader, providing high quality teambuilding and high adventure activities to the center’s guests. Essential Functions- Camp Programs Serves as Director for Mud Camp, Camp Able & other camp/youth programs o Hire/train/retain/manage/recruit seasonal staff of nearly 80-100 o Develop marketing strategies to maximize enrollment at each day camp session o Develop program plans to strengthen current programs, and develop opportunities to expand into new programs o Develop leadership training to provide teens opportunities to learn new skills o Develop program priorities and build relationships to support overnight outreach camp, a free camp for outreach program participants. This program is provided in unison with Mud Camp. o Develops policies and activities according to guidelines as specified by Safe Church (Episcopal Church), and the American Camp Association o Lead excursion programs like ski trips o Launch additional camp/youth opportunities at St. Columba as a means for expanding ministries, reaching new revenue targets, and taking on new initiatives o Develop program priorities, marketing, recruitment, vendor relationships o Attend and nurture youth ministry programs and relationships in the Diocese and beyond Essential Functions- St. Columba Camp and Retreat Center Serves as primary coordinator, leader, trainer, and supervisor for St. Columba’s ASCEND High Adventure Course, teambuilding, and water-based programs. o Determines needs of each visiting group and schedules add-on programs. Assistant Director – Sawtooth United Methodist Camp

Site Name: Sawtooth United Methodist Camp Position Title: Assistant Director Position Type:  Year-Round Location (city and state): Fairfied, Idaho Salary Range: $9,000 to $10,000 Job Description: The assistant director will work closely with the director with the goal of taking over from the current director. The position is full-time during the months camps are scheduled, typically June through August, and part-time the rest of the year. The assistant director is expected to be at camp most of the time during the months camps are scheduled. Housing and meals are provided at the camp during those months. The current Director will train the assistant director in the areas of administration, staff and volunteer recruiting, grounds and building maintenance, vehicle and equipment maintenance, hospitality, food service, health and safety, required regulations and standards, schedule and support camp programs, the camp turnover process, and opening and closing of the site.
